> I found that hover can reflect the label text, and label can indeed be 
> assigned per atom.
> So, as long as you don't need to use labels, this seems to do the trick:
> 
> hover %[label]; //affects all atoms
> select _N;
> label this is a nitrogen;
> set labelToggle {selected}; //turns label off without resetting it
> select _O;
> label this is an oxygen;
> set labelToggle {selected};
> select all;
